Imagine a reader hears about your book today.

They search your name online.

What do they find?

Your website is your digital home. Unlike social media, it's a place you control and where readers can always learn more about you and your books.

A professional author website can help you:

📖 Showcase all your books in one place.

📩 Build an email list of loyal readers.

📝 Share your story and connect with your audience.

🛒 Make it easier for readers to purchase your books.

Whether you've published one book or ten, a website helps you present yourself as a serious author and creates trust with new readers.

Many authors spend months, even years, writing an incredible book, yet overlook one of the most important parts of connecting with readers: their author brand.

Your brand is more than a logo or a color palette. It's the overall impression readers get when they visit your profile, website, or social media.

A professional author brand helps readers feel:

Confidence in your work

Trust in your expertise

Excitement to explore your books

Three simple ways to strengthen your author brand:

✅ Use consistent colors, fonts, and visuals.

✅ Maintain a professional online presence.

✅ Share valuable content that educates and inspires your audience.

Readers are more likely to support authors who appear trustworthy and consistent.

HOW SHOULD READERS FEEL AFTER YOUR BOOK?

Readers may not remember every chapter.

They may not remember every character.

But they'll almost always remember how your story made them feel.

The strongest books leave readers with something lasting, hope, courage, healing, curiosity, joy, or a new perspective.

When you write with purpose, your story becomes more than entertainment. It becomes an experience.

Many authors believe publishing their book is the finish line.

In reality, it's the starting point.

A well-written book can still remain invisible if readers never discover it.

Success today isn't only about writing. It's also about helping the right readers find your work through consistent visibility, thoughtful branding, and meaningful engagement.

You don't have to market every hour of the day. You simply need a strategy that keeps your book in front of the people who are most likely to enjoy it.
